Safety precautions
2WARNING

2CAUTION

To prevent injury or fire, take the
following precautions:

To prevent damage to the machine, take
the following precautions:

• Insert the unit all the way in until it is fully locked
in place. Otherwise it may fall out of place when
jolted.
• When extending the ignition, battery, or ground
wires, make sure to use automotive-grade wires
or other wires with a 0.75mm2 (AWG18) or more
to prevent wire deterioration and damage to the
wire coating.
• To prevent a short circuit, never put or leave any
metallic objects (such as coins or metal tools)
inside the unit.
• If the unit starts to emit smoke or strange smells,
turn off the power immediately and consult your
Kenwood dealer.

• Make sure to ground the unit to a negative 12V
DC power supply.
• Do not open the top or bottom covers of the unit.
• Do not install the unit in a spot exposed to direct
sunlight or excessive heat or humidity.
• When replacing a fuse, only use a new one with
the prescribed rating. Using a fuse with the wrong
rating may cause your unit to malfunction.
• To prevent a short circuit when replacing a fuse,
first disconnect the wiring harness.
• Do not use your own screws. Use only the screws
provided. If you use the wrong screws, you could
damage the unit.

About CD players/disc changers
connected to this unit
Kenwood disc changers/ CD players released in
1998 or later can be connected to this unit.
Refer to the catalog or consult your Kenwood
dealer for connectable models of disc changers/
CD players.
Note that any Kenwood disc changers/ CD players
released in 1997 or earlier and disc changers made
by other makers cannot be connected to this unit.
Unsupported connection may result in damage.
Setting the "O-N" Switch to the "N" position for the
applicable Kenwood disc changers/ CD players.
The functions that can be used and the information
that can be displayed will differ depending on the
models being connected.
• You can damage both your unit and the CD changer if
you connect them incorrectly.

Do Not Load 3-in. CDs in the CD slot
If you try to load a 3 in. (8cm) CD with its adapter
into the unit, the adapter might separate from the
CD and damage the unit.

Lens Fogging
Right after you turn on the heater in cold weather,
dew or condensation may form on the lens in the
CD player of the unit. Called lens fogging, CDs
may be impossible to play. In such a situation,
remove the disc and wait for the condensation to
evaporate. If the unit still does not operate normally
after a while, consult your Kenwood dealer.
